## Auth

The replica-lag alarm for Coppermine reads lag metrics from the Quillbox stats service every 30s. It fires when lag exceeds 45s for three consecutive polls. All calls to Quillbox require a service key; there is no anonymous read path. Rotate the key quarterly via the platform vault job — do not mint keys by hand. If the alarm goes silent, check key expiry first; a 401 from Quillbox fails closed and suppresses paging. The alarm's poller authenticates with the key directly below.

service key, fawip-bajef: kto11_Qt5wZK9vdNC

## Deployment

Quick heads-up before you approve: we slimmed the Quillhopper image down from 1.2 GB to about 180 MB by switching to a distroless base and dropping the build toolchain in a multi-stage build. Startup is noticeably faster on the Brindlewood cluster now. Nothing in the app code changed, just packaging. The runtime picks up its settings at boot, and these are the values it currently ships with.

service settings:
PRAIX_LOG_LEVEL=error
PRAIX_METRICS_HOST=metrics.praix.qorvelcorp.corp
PRAIX_POOL_SIZE=16

## Service Accounts: replica-lag-watcher

This page documents the service account used by the Lagbeacon alarm on the Ostermere read-replica cluster. The account holds read-only access to replication metrics and may page the on-call rotation when lag exceeds threshold. Scope was reviewed last quarter and narrowed to metrics endpoints only. For audit completeness, the currently active key is recorded immediately below.

API key for kahop-bagef: zpat2_yb

The Ledgerholm ingestion API writes events into tables partitioned by calendar month. Each request is routed to the partition matching the event's timestamp, not arrival time, so late-arriving data lands correctly. New team members should note that queries spanning multiple months must set the range header explicitly; otherwise only the current partition is scanned. All partition-management endpoints require authentication against the internal Partition Registry service, using the key provided below.

API key for tagug-tajef: vxb4-R1fo